Binoculars, telescopes and optical instruments

Consumer goods

In short
Responsible person or authorised representative established in the Union

Who has to appoint one

Manufacturers and sellers outside the Union placing optical instruments on the EU market. Thermal imaging and night vision devices are additionally dual-use items subject to export control, which affects intra-company transfers as well as sales.

Thresholds and exemptions

Dual-use thresholds are technical, based on resolution, frame rate and spectral range, and are set out in Annex I of Regulation 2021/821.

What must appear on the label

Manufacturer and responsible person details, model and batch identification, and for powered or connected instruments CE marking, electrical ratings and the WEEE symbol. Laser rangefinders carry the laser class marking.

Marketplace fields

Marketplaces restrict thermal and night vision optics in several member states, and export control screening applies to shipments even inside the Union in some cases.

Documentation you must hold

Technical documentation and risk analysis, electrical and radio documentation for powered models, laser safety classification for rangefinders, and export control classification for thermal and night vision products.

Standards and testing

EN 60825-1 for laser safety where a rangefinder or pointer is included, electrical and EMC testing for powered instruments, and optical performance verification where magnification or resolution is claimed.

Language requirements

Instructions and safety warnings, in particular the warning never to view the sun, in the language of each member state of sale.

When it applies

Before placing on the market. Export control licences must be obtained before shipment where the item is listed.

How long records are kept

Ten years, and export control records per national law.

What happens if you do not comply

Withdrawal and fines under product law, and separately criminal penalties for unlicensed export of controlled dual-use items, which is enforced seriously.

Who enforces it

Market surveillance authorities, customs and national export control authorities.

Where the boundary lies

Thermal imaging is the trap: a hunting scope can exceed the dual-use thresholds and require a licence, and sellers who treat it as ordinary consumer optics discover this at customs. Laser rangefinders bring laser safety classification on top.

Questions we are asked

Are thermal scopes export controlled?
Above defined resolution and frame rate thresholds, yes, under Regulation 2021/821, with licensing required for export and in some cases for transfer.
Do telescopes need CE marking?
Only if they contain electrical or radio components. Purely optical instruments follow GPSR.
